A true left-handed thinner. Forged for the left hand — not a right-hand thinner flipped over.

Most “left-handed” thinners in Australia are right-handed forgings with the screw on the opposite side. Anyone who's actually left-handed and tried one knows what that feels like — the blade lay is wrong, the finger ring sits at the wrong angle, and your thumb fights the cut on every pass. The Geisha Left-Handed Thinner is built from a true left-hand forging in Japanese Cobalt Alloy. The bevel, the pivot tension, and the offset handle are all engineered around how the left hand actually moves through hair.

Technical Specifications

  • Steel: Japanese Cobalt Alloy
  • Rockwell Hardness: 56–58 HRC
  • Blade Lengths: 5.5" / 6.0"
  • Blade Type: 30-tooth Radial (Left-Hand forging)
  • Handle: Offset Ergonomic — Left-Handed
  • Bearing System: Single Bearing Flat
  • Origin: Forged in Japan, hand-finished by Matt
